“…In the case of the absorption of Hg 2+ in the CaCO3 slurry, it is necessary to limit the phenomenon of re-emission. This phenomenon is limited by the additive which, when is added to the slurry in the absorber, forms mercury sulphide (HgS), which is a stable compound (up to the temperature of 265 ℃ [11]) and insoluble in water [12]. At the same time other metals dissolved in the suspension are also removed (Zn, Cd, Pb, Cr, Cu, Ni, Mn and Fe), which reduces their concentration in the wastewater from the FGD installation.…”
